Abstract:The purpose of this article is to investigate dancer-researcher-performer (BPI), the Brazilian method of dance composition that was created by professor Graziela Rodrigues in the 1980s. The article aims at showing how such practices are developed from the experience of a performer in relation to some popular manifestation such as a festivity or another cultural event.
